Maximum Social Security Benefit: Worker Retiring at Full Retirement Age in 2014: $2,642/mo.

$721 is the maximum Supplemental Security Income (SSI), which is a separate benefit based on need.
If we assume that the seniors in question worked enough to be eligible for regular social security benefits and meet the income requirements for SSI, then they would get their regular SS benefits PLUS the SSI benefits.
I'll grant that social security isn't much to live on, but it's not quite as dire as "The max Social Security check anyone can get isn't enough to cover rent, much less anything else."
